Output d62f361b407dfd990f8354d5dd53f5f9f59dd0e7ba45290af531e5ee3d59e84b:10

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c46e25c99cc50ef5d56b17f18d72e0f53030963e OP_EQUAL
address
3KbeKLEf3G6noszvqerYqY59RSKpkif8bh
transaction
d62f361b407dfd990f8354d5dd53f5f9f59dd0e7ba45290af531e5ee3d59e84b
spent
true